2015-06-09 5 views
5

मुझे एहसास है कि यह एक सरल उदाहरण है, लेकिन मैं कुछ स्पष्टीकरण प्राप्त करना चाहता था कि हैंडऑनटेबल एक कंटेनर के भीतर व्यवहार करने की अपेक्षा करता है। जैसे हमारे पास एक टैब है जहां हम होट डालते हैं और हम इसे 100% कंटेनर स्पेस का उपभोग करना चाहते हैं, लेकिन अभी यह बाधित नहीं प्रतीत होता है।हाथों को रोकना अपने मूल कंटेनर के आकार के लिए

यहां एक उदाहरण है। हम इसे लाल बॉक्स के अंदर बाध्य करना चाहते हैं।

http://jsfiddle.net/jxh52650/

<div style="height: 100px; width: 100px; background-color: red;"><div id="example1" class="hot handsontable" ></div></div> 

उत्तर

3

दुर्भाग्य से लाल बेला में नहीं दिख रहा है, लेकिन मुझे लगता है कि क्या आप चाहते हैं stretchH:"all" संपत्ति है। यह सुनिश्चित करता है कि यदि आप पैरेंट कंटेनर पर width सेट करते हैं, तो यह 100% भरने के लिए सभी कॉलम फैलाएगा। उसके बाद, आप कंटेनर की शैली को overflow:auto पर सेट करना चाहते हैं जो एचओटी आवृत्ति को चौड़ाई और ऊंचाई निर्दिष्ट कर देगा, और उसके बाद स्क्रॉल बार का उपयोग करें।

+0

धन्यवाद, यह सहायक था। अतिप्रवाह = छुपा हुआ अतिप्रवाह = ऑटो से बेहतर काम करना प्रतीत होता है। अतिप्रवाह = ऑटो अच्छी तरह से काम नहीं किया था। मैंने ग्रिड के चारों ओर एक बोर्डर्ड बॉक्स को शामिल करने की कोशिश की और आकार बदलना प्रतीत होता था। मैंने 300px के माता-पिता div, 300px द्वारा और 30px की पैडिंग शामिल की, इसलिए मैं लाल पृष्ठभूमि देख सकता था। लेकिन मुझे 300px तक ग्रिड को 300px तक आकार देने की आवश्यकता थी ताकि यह सभी अंदरूनी जगह ले सके। क्या यह एक आर्टिफैक्ट है कि ग्रिड कैसा चल रहा है? ' [http://jsfiddle.net/4yne0xbx/] ' अधिकांश लोग ऐसे क्षेत्रों को कैसे संभालते हैं जहां वे ग्रिड माता-पिता के पूर्ण आकार का उपभोग करना चाहते हैं? – bkbonner

+0

स्वरूपण @ZekeDroid के बारे में खेद है। मैंने इसे ठीक करने की कोशिश की, लेकिन मुझे नहीं पता था कि संपादन पर समय सीमा थी। – bkbonner

+0

अच्छी तरह से, माता-पिता की चौड़ाई होने पर हमेशा 'चौड़ाई: 100%' का उपयोग कर सकते हैं। वह पूरी चौड़ाई ले जाएगा। ऊंचाई थोड़ा कठिन है। साथ ही, याद रखें कि पैडिंग में 4 वैकल्पिक तर्क होते हैं। आपने इसे केवल एक दिया है, इसलिए यह आपको शीर्ष पैडिंग देता है (यह शीर्ष पर शुरू होता है और फिर घड़ी की दिशा में जाता है, उदाहरण के लिए, दूसरा तर्क सही है) – ZekeDroid

संबंधित मुद्दे